The High Court of Punjab dismissed Income-tax Cases Nos. 4 and 5 of 1957 as no question of law arose. Legal and traveling expenses incurred by the assessee-company in defending a winding up petition were held deductible under section 10(2)(xv) of the Income-tax Act, following the decision in Morgan v. Tate & Lyle Ltd. No costs were awarded.
